In Princess and the Frog, after wishing upon a star, Tiana’s dreams finally begin to come true when she is visited by a frog who turns out to be a prince. Desperate to become a human again, Prince Naveen begs to have Tiana kiss him but she is not so sure. Of course Tiana is not about kissing a frog. I mean they are covered in mucus just for starters. But after the devastating loss of her dream restaurant and the promise by the rich Prince Naveen to grant her whatever she wants she’s willing to make an exception. So Tiana goes for it! She goes in to smooch that amphibian right on the mouth and suddenly becomes a frog herself… Now this wasn’t a super big deal to me… until I realized that Naveen kisses Tiana’s best friend Lottie at the end of the film and nothing happens to her! Why does Tiana become tied to the curse while Charlotte doesn’t?

About YouTube 📺

YouTube, an American video-sharing website based in San Bruno, California, offers a diverse range of user-generated and corporate media content. 🌟

Content and Users 🎵

Users can upload, view, rate, share, and comment on videos, with content spanning video clips, music videos, live streams, and more.

While most content is uploaded by individuals, media corporations like CBS and the BBC also contribute. Unregistered users can watch videos, while registered users enjoy additional privileges such as uploading unlimited videos and adding comments.

Monetization and Impact 🤑

YouTube and creators earn revenue through Google AdSense, with most videos free to view. Premium channels and subscription services like YouTube Music and YouTube Premium offer ad-free streaming.

As of February 2017, over 400 hours of content were uploaded to YouTube every minute, with the site ranking as the second-most popular globally. By May 2019, this figure exceeded 500 hours per minute. 📈
